While patients are briefly radioactive, the exposure is carefully calculated to be as low as reasonably achievable (ALARA). A common example is the PET scan, which uses a radioactive sugar tracer to identify cancer cells, as they consume glucose at a much higher rate than normal cells.

The radioactive materials used have short half-lives, meaning they decay quickly and exit the body through natural processes such as urine or feces. Gamma cameras and PET scanners are equipped with detectors that convert emitted radiation into detailed digital images.
